Description

Knight Court is a tiny chess-like abstract. Each side has a knight, bishop, and rook on a 3x3 board.

A captured bishop or rook is returned to its owner, who can re-introduce it onto any open space on a future turn. In contrast, a knight in jeopardy of capture is compelled to move, because checkmating an opponent's knight wins the game.
